Population Overview

Algonquin village is a mid-sized community located in Illinois. The total population is 29,904. It ranks as the 66th most populous out of 1,445 cities and towns in Illinois.

Age Demographics

The median age in Algonquin village is 41.3 years. This is 6% higher than the state median of 38.9 years.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Algonquin village is $131,753. This is 61% higher than the state median of $81,702.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 68% higher. The poverty rate stands at 4.5%. This is 62% lower than the state poverty rate of 11.7%. This exceptionally low poverty rate indicates strong economic prosperity across the community. The unemployment rate is 4.4%. This is 25% lower than the state rate of 5.8%. The median home value is $324,000. Housing costs are 29% higher than the state median of $250,500.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.5x, Algonquin village is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 87.8%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 31% higher than the state average of 66.8%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Algonquin village is White (non-Hispanic), making up 74.0% of the population.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 14.2%. The Black or African American population (2.2%) is well below the state average of 13.6%.

Education

43.6%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 17% higher than the state rate of 37.2%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 95.2%. Notably, 15.9% of adults hold a graduate or professional degree, indicating a highly educated workforce.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Algonquin village, Illinois is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against Illinois state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 1,445 Census-designated places in Illinois.
